Prior to you begin, wear your safety and security gear, including goggles, handwear covers, and strong footwear. Make sure your work space is free from challenges and dangers that might cause crashes. Constantly work from a stable surface area, and never use a ladder while stress cleaning.

When operating the device, keep a company grasp and keep the nozzle directed away from on your own and others. Utilize the best nozzle for the task; a larger spray is safer for delicate surface areas. Beginning with a lower stress setup and gradually increase it as needed.

Constantly know your environments, especially when working near website traffic or pedestrians. Stay clear of pressure washing in wet conditions, as this enhances the risk of slips and falls.

After you finish, shut off the equipment and eliminate any stress in the hoses before detaching them. Complying with these ideal techniques will aid you remain secure and achieve fantastic outcomes.

Emergency Situation Readiness and Emergency Treatment



Accidents can take place despite your best efforts to operate securely. That's why having a solid emergency situation preparedness strategy is important when pressure cleaning.

First, ensure you've obtained a well-stocked first aid kit accessible. It needs to include band-aids, bactericides, gauze, and burn lotion. Familiarize yourself with the area of the package so you can reach it rapidly if required.

Next off, understand the emergency situation numbers in your area. If a mishap occurs, you'll wish to act quick and call for help readily.

Furthermore, consider having a buddy system in place. Functioning alongside someone means you can assist each other in case of an emergency.

Constantly maintain a phone close by for emergencies and make sure it's billed. If you're utilizing chemicals or high-pressure equipment, know their safety and security data sheets (SDS) and what to do if direct exposure occurs.

Finally, practice standard first aid abilities. Knowing just how to treat cuts, burns, or strains can make a significant difference in an emergency situation.
